Scalarworks Ar-15 1.57'' 34Mm Leap/09 Qd Ring Mount Black

SKU:
167526841
|
UPC:
856481007454
$439.00
Current Stock:
LEAP/09 34MM QUICK DETACH SCOPE MOUNTS